Diving into the Googleverse: How to Grab Your Key
First things first, fire up your favorite web browser. Chrome, Safari, Firefox, even that old Internet Explorer thingy hiding in the corner – they all work. Then, type "Create a Google account" into the search bar. Bam! You'll see a link that says something like "Create your Google Account." Click it! Adventure awaits!

Now, you're staring at a form. Don't panic! It's not a pop quiz. Think of it as your application to join the coolest club on the internet.
The form asks for some basic info. Your first name. Your last name. Easy peasy, right? Type those in. Make sure you spell them right – unless you want to be known as "Bobber" instead of "Robert" for all eternity.

Next up, you get to choose your username. This is like your superhero name in the Googleverse! It's the part before the "@gmail.com" in your email address. Get creative! Try something unique. If your name is common, you might need to add some numbers or extra letters to make it stand out. Don't be surprised if your first few choices are already taken. Just keep trying – you'll find the perfect one!
Okay, now for the password. This is super important! Think of it as the secret code to your Batcave. Make it strong, make it memorable (but not too memorable – don't use "password123"). Use a mix of letters, numbers, and symbols to make it extra secure. Write it down somewhere safe in case you forget. Trust me, you'll thank yourself later.
The Fun Continues! (Almost There!)
After you've wrestled with the password creation, Google will ask for a few more details. Like your birthday. This helps them personalize your experience (and probably sends you a fun birthday email!).

Then, it asks for your gender. Choose whatever option feels right for you. Or, choose "Rather not say." It's totally up to you! This is your Google adventure, after all.
Next up is the recovery email address and phone number. This is your safety net! If you ever forget your password, Google can use this info to help you get back into your account. Seriously, don't skip this step. It's like having a spare key hidden under the flower pot – you hope you never need it, but you're so glad it's there when you do.

Read through the Terms of Service and Privacy Policy. I know, I know, it's long and boring. But it's important to know what you're agreeing to. If you're okay with everything, click "I agree."
And… BOOM! You've done it! You're officially the proud owner of a brand-spanking-new Google account!
